Web25 aug. 2016 · This is where wrap-up codes come in. They are a quick way to summarize all that happened in a call. For example, an agent can tag a call as ‘billing query’, and the resolution as ‘query resolved’. It is simple, easily understandable, and quick to record. Call disposition code or activity codes are the labels that are used to describe the outcome of a call. These labels can later be used to obtain the useful business analytics. When someone calls into a contact centre or an agent makes an outbound call, disposition codes are used as shorthand to describe what the communication was about. WebAgents select a disposition code from a list when they wrap up a call. You must first create the individual disposition codes and then you can create a disposition list that includes a selection of those codes. Creating a Disposition Code. Disposition codes are the individual codes that are used to identify the nature or outcome of your ...
